Training artificial intelligence to generate coherent and contextually accurate text involves several crucial steps. The process is built upon the concept of teaching machines to understand and produce human-like language through data and algorithms. By leveraging deep learning models, AI can be taught to mimic the structure, tone, and style of written content.

Key Steps in Training AI for Text Generation:

  • Data Collection: Gathering diverse datasets to ensure the AI can learn from a broad range of topics.
  • Preprocessing: Cleaning and structuring data for better model input.
  • Model Selection: Choosing an appropriate deep learning architecture like GPT or Transformer-based models.

"Data diversity is key in ensuring AI generates relevant and unbiased content across different contexts."

Important Considerations:

Factor Description
Dataset Quality Higher-quality datasets lead to more accurate and nuanced text generation.
Model Size Larger models typically provide more diverse and context-aware outputs but require more computational power.
Evaluation Continuous evaluation helps fine-tune the model for better performance and accuracy in real-world applications.

Training AI to Generate Text

Training an artificial intelligence model to generate human-like text involves a multi-step process. It requires large datasets, complex algorithms, and advanced machine learning techniques. By using these elements, an AI can understand language patterns, context, and the structure of sentences to produce coherent and contextually relevant text.

The training process begins with data collection, where vast amounts of written material are used to teach the model. These materials often come from books, articles, and websites, which provide the AI with diverse examples of language use. As the AI learns, it begins to recognize the relationships between words and how they form meaningful sentences.

Key Steps in AI Text Generation

  1. Data Preparation: Collecting and organizing large datasets from a variety of sources.
  2. Model Architecture: Designing the neural network that will process the data and learn from it.
  3. Training the Model: Feeding the data into the model and adjusting the parameters based on the output.
  4. Fine-tuning: Making adjustments to improve accuracy and quality of the generated text.

Once trained, the AI can generate text that mimics the style, tone, and context of the original data. This capability can be used in a variety of applications, from chatbots to content creation tools.

"AI-driven text generation can significantly reduce time spent on content creation while maintaining high quality and relevance."

Challenges in Training AI for Text Generation

  • Data Bias: The AI may inherit biases present in the training data.
  • Context Understanding: AI models might struggle to understand nuances or long-term context in conversations.
  • Quality Control: Ensuring the AI generates text that is both accurate and meaningful can be difficult.

Performance Comparison

AI Model Training Time Text Quality
GPT-3 Weeks High
BERT Months Moderate

Choosing the Right AI Model for Text Generation

When selecting an AI model for generating text, it is crucial to consider the specific requirements of the task at hand. Different AI models excel in different aspects, such as creativity, coherence, or technical accuracy. Choosing the right one depends on whether the primary goal is to produce conversational dialogue, technical documentation, or creative content. Understanding these distinctions can help in narrowing down the best-suited model for your needs.

Another key factor is the model's performance based on training data, size, and underlying architecture. While larger models may produce more coherent and nuanced text, they might not be necessary for all applications. Smaller, specialized models can be more efficient for specific tasks, providing fast and accurate responses without the overhead of larger models. It's important to evaluate the trade-offs between quality, speed, and computational resources.

Factors to Consider When Selecting an AI Model

  • Purpose: Define the task – whether it's creative writing, technical explanation, or casual dialogue.
  • Training Data: Consider the quality and domain-specificity of the data the model was trained on.
  • Size: Larger models may generate more fluent and diverse text but require more resources.
  • Response Time: Some models prioritize speed over depth, so consider if real-time performance is necessary.

Model Types Overview

Model Type Best For Pros Cons
GPT-3.5 General-purpose content generation Versatile, high-quality output, large knowledge base Expensive, slower response time
BERT Contextual text understanding Good for understanding context, search tasks Not designed for generation, more suited for classification
Custom Fine-tuned Models Specialized tasks Highly accurate for specific domains Requires large datasets for training

Tip: Always test different models on a small scale before committing to large-scale deployment. Performance can vary based on the specific application and context.

Steps to Train AI for Specific Writing Styles

Training AI to replicate specific writing styles requires a systematic approach that combines data preparation, model selection, and fine-tuning techniques. The key to success is providing the model with quality, style-specific data and then refining its understanding through iterative processes. Whether the goal is to imitate a formal academic tone or a casual conversational style, the steps outlined below will help guide the development process.

To achieve optimal results, it’s essential to understand the components of the style you wish to replicate. This involves not just vocabulary and sentence structure, but also tone, rhythm, and overall voice. The more specific the target style, the more precise the training data needs to be.

Steps for Style-Specific AI Training

  1. Data Collection: Gather a comprehensive set of texts that represent the desired writing style. These texts should be high-quality examples that align with the target tone and structure.
  2. Preprocessing Data: Clean and format the collected data to remove irrelevant information, ensuring that it fits the style and structure you aim to replicate.
  3. Model Selection: Choose a model architecture that supports fine-tuning for style-specific tasks. Transformer-based models like GPT or BERT are commonly used for this purpose.
  4. Fine-Tuning: Train the model on the prepared dataset. During this stage, focus on optimizing the model’s ability to mimic the nuances of the target writing style.
  5. Evaluation: After training, assess the model’s output to ensure it aligns with the desired style. Metrics like fluency, coherence, and tone consistency should be evaluated.

Important Considerations

Fine-tuning requires substantial computational resources and time. It is important to evaluate results iteratively and adjust training parameters accordingly.

Example: Evaluating Style Consistency

Style Attribute Formal Style Conversational Style
Vocabulary Advanced, technical Simple, colloquial
Sentence Length Long, complex Short, straightforward
Tone Objective, neutral Friendly, informal

Optimizing Results

  • Iterative Refinement: Continuously retrain the model using new data or improved datasets to address inconsistencies and enhance output quality.
  • Customization: Add extra layers to the model that can capture subtle shifts in tone, voice, or even humor.
  • Testing: Conduct A/B testing with different text samples to measure the effectiveness of the trained AI model in various scenarios.

Optimizing AI Output for Clarity and Engagement

When training an AI to generate text, the focus should be on enhancing its ability to communicate ideas clearly while maintaining the reader's attention. AI-generated content needs to avoid ambiguity and be structured in a way that leads the audience through the information smoothly. To achieve this, the AI must be optimized in a way that encourages readability and engagement. This involves both the content itself and the format in which it is presented.

To optimize AI-generated text for clarity and engagement, several strategies must be employed. These strategies include refining the language, structuring the text for easy navigation, and ensuring the content resonates with the target audience. Below are key practices to enhance AI output:

1. Refining Language and Structure

  • Use of simple language: Avoid complex sentence structures or overly technical terms that could alienate a broad audience.
  • Consistent tone: Maintain a uniform voice that aligns with the topic and the intended readers.
  • Clear transitions: Ensure smooth transitions between ideas and paragraphs to guide the reader through the text seamlessly.

2. Engaging the Audience

  1. Interactive elements: Incorporate questions, calls to action, or relatable anecdotes that foster connection with the audience.
  2. Use of storytelling: Present information through a narrative framework to captivate readers and make the content more memorable.

3. Formatting for Readability

Formatting plays a crucial role in the ease with which content is consumed. The following elements help break up dense text and keep the reader's attention:

Formatting Element Purpose
Headings and subheadings Organize content, making it easier for readers to navigate and find specific information.
Bullet points Provide concise, easily digestible pieces of information.
Short paragraphs Improve readability and prevent overwhelming the reader with large blocks of text.

"Clear communication is not just about simplicity, but about ensuring that the message is effectively conveyed without losing the audience's interest."

Integrating Custom Data to Enhance Text Relevance

Incorporating domain-specific datasets into machine learning models significantly enhances the accuracy and relevance of the generated text. By feeding models with custom data, we enable them to learn the nuances and specificities of particular fields or topics. This approach ensures that the content generated is tailored, contextual, and more aligned with the intended purpose.

Moreover, the process of fine-tuning AI models with proprietary datasets involves a series of steps that refine the model's output, making it more aligned with specific user needs. The quality of the text produced improves as the model becomes familiar with specialized terms, sentence structures, and unique patterns found in the custom data.

Key Approaches for Custom Data Integration

  • Data Preprocessing: Clean and organize the data to ensure it’s in a format that the model can easily process.
  • Fine-Tuning: Adjusting pre-trained models using domain-specific data to improve accuracy and relevance.
  • Continuous Updates: Regularly refresh the data input to keep the model aligned with the latest trends and information.

"Custom datasets enhance text generation by allowing the AI to focus on specific terminologies and contexts, providing more useful and precise outputs."

Custom Data Integration Process

  1. Collect and prepare relevant data sources.
  2. Train the model using the custom dataset.
  3. Test the model for accuracy and fine-tune based on feedback.
  4. Deploy the model and continuously monitor performance.

Example of Custom Data Impact

Standard Dataset Custom Dataset
General language model with broad knowledge. Model trained with healthcare-related text, improving medical advice generation.
Basic text generation. Tailored text with medical terminology, leading to more accurate and contextually relevant output.

Establishing Feedback Mechanisms for Ongoing Model Enhancement

Building a reliable and efficient AI model requires continuous improvements to ensure optimal performance. One key element in maintaining this quality is the establishment of feedback loops, which allow the model to learn from its mistakes and adapt. These loops not only refine the model but also ensure that it remains relevant as new data or requirements emerge.

In the process of AI training, feedback mechanisms provide the essential data for pinpointing weaknesses and areas of growth. With each cycle, these mechanisms refine the algorithms, enhancing both accuracy and response quality. Setting up these loops is an ongoing task that demands structured monitoring and regular updates.

Key Elements of Effective Feedback Loops

  • Data Collection: Consistently gathering performance data is the first step in establishing feedback loops. This includes user interactions, error reports, and other performance metrics.
  • Model Evaluation: Regularly assessing the model’s outputs ensures that it aligns with intended goals. Identifying discrepancies in output quality is essential for improving the model’s responses.
  • Adjustment and Re-training: After identifying gaps in performance, the model should be adjusted and retrained with new data. This step is crucial to eliminating errors and enhancing accuracy over time.

Process of Implementing a Feedback Loop

  1. Define clear objectives for performance metrics (e.g., accuracy, relevance).
  2. Implement systems to collect relevant data on model performance and user feedback.
  3. Analyze the feedback to identify trends, issues, and areas of improvement.
  4. Update the model’s training set, incorporating the feedback for better precision.
  5. Monitor the changes over time and repeat the cycle as needed for continuous improvement.

Remember: The efficiency of feedback loops heavily depends on how quickly and effectively data can be gathered and implemented back into the training cycle. The faster the iterations, the quicker the model adapts to changing inputs.

Measuring the Impact of Feedback Loops

Metric Before Feedback Loop After Feedback Loop
Accuracy 85% 92%
Response Time 200ms 150ms
User Satisfaction 70% 85%

Managing AI Content Quality and Consistency

Ensuring the quality and consistency of content generated by AI is critical for maintaining a reliable and engaging user experience. By carefully monitoring output, setting clear parameters, and applying feedback loops, it is possible to minimize errors and optimize performance. Moreover, consistency is necessary for keeping the tone, style, and structure in line with the intended voice and purpose, which enhances credibility and reader trust.

To effectively manage the AI-generated content, it is essential to establish specific guidelines for training data, define the desired content output, and regularly audit the generated text. In this way, it becomes easier to spot inconsistencies or potential issues before they reach the audience, ensuring that all outputs remain aligned with the brand's voice and standards.

Key Practices for Maintaining Quality and Consistency

  • Data Refinement: Continuously improving the training dataset to reduce bias and improve language generation accuracy.
  • Clear Output Guidelines: Defining specific expectations for tone, structure, and style to ensure uniformity across generated texts.
  • Regular Auditing: Implementing a process for reviewing and assessing AI outputs, focusing on detecting any deviations from the desired quality.

Challenges in Quality Control

Managing AI content quality involves balancing automated generation with human oversight. Without intervention, AI may produce inaccurate or irrelevant outputs that could negatively affect the user experience.

Tools for Monitoring AI Content

  1. AI Content Review Software: Tools designed to analyze and flag issues in AI-generated content, ensuring adherence to quality guidelines.
  2. Human-in-the-loop Systems: Incorporating human editors to review and adjust AI-generated content to meet the required standards.
  3. Real-time Feedback Systems: Implementing a feedback loop where AI can learn from corrections and improve over time.

Sample Quality Check Metrics

Metric Target Action
Consistency High Ensure adherence to tone and style guidelines
Accuracy 90%+ Review training data for biases and update regularly
Relevance High Regularly audit output for alignment with user needs

Assessing the Effectiveness of AI-Generated Text

Evaluating the quality of text produced by artificial intelligence is a critical task for determining its practical applications. The metrics used to assess AI-generated content can vary depending on the specific goals of the task, such as coherence, relevance, and linguistic accuracy. These measurements help in understanding how well the AI mimics human-like writing and its potential to be integrated into real-world applications, such as content creation, automated communication, and more.

Success measurement typically involves both qualitative and quantitative approaches, providing a well-rounded view of the AI's capabilities. Key factors to consider include grammar and syntax, semantic understanding, and the ability to engage the audience. To truly measure how well an AI model performs, a combination of user feedback, objective metrics, and comparative analysis with human-written text is essential.

Key Metrics for Evaluation

  • Coherence: How logically the ideas flow within the generated text.
  • Relevance: The degree to which the content stays on topic and meets user needs.
  • Grammar and Syntax: The structural accuracy of sentences, punctuation, and word usage.
  • Creativity: The originality and innovation displayed in the content.

Methods of Evaluation

  1. Automated Scoring Systems: Tools like BLEU or ROUGE compare the generated text to reference texts, scoring them based on matching phrases or structures.
  2. Human Evaluation: Expert reviewers assess the text for quality, clarity, and engagement. This approach is subjective but often provides valuable insights.
  3. User Feedback: Gathering responses from the target audience helps determine whether the text resonates with readers or serves its intended purpose effectively.

Comparison of Metrics

Metric Definition Evaluation Method
Coherence Logical flow of ideas in the text. Human evaluation or automated coherence checks.
Relevance Text's alignment with the topic or user needs. Comparison with predefined criteria or user surveys.
Creativity Uniqueness and originality of content. Expert review or creative content scoring tools.

"The ability to adapt the writing style to match different contexts and audiences is crucial for determining the true success of AI-generated content."

Scaling AI Writing for Large Content Needs

As organizations increasingly demand high volumes of content, AI-powered writing solutions are becoming essential. Scaling AI writing to meet large content needs requires both advanced models and efficient workflows. This involves leveraging AI to create large-scale content while ensuring quality, coherence, and relevance across a wide range of topics.

Successfully scaling AI writing capabilities also necessitates robust infrastructure to handle the load and produce content that aligns with specific audience requirements. By optimizing the AI’s training and fine-tuning processes, businesses can significantly enhance productivity and maintain a consistent output across multiple platforms.

Key Factors in Scaling AI Writing

  • Model Training: Customizing AI models for specific industries or niches can greatly improve the relevance and accuracy of generated content.
  • Content Management: Implementing structured workflows and content categorization can streamline large-scale content production.
  • Quality Control: Using automated tools to check grammar, tone, and factual accuracy helps maintain high-quality standards in large volumes of content.

Steps to Implement AI-Driven Large-Scale Content Creation

  1. Define Content Requirements: Clearly outline the type of content, target audience, and frequency of publication.
  2. Integrate AI Writing Tools: Choose and integrate appropriate AI writing platforms that can handle the specific scale and complexity of the content.
  3. Monitor and Optimize: Regularly evaluate content quality and adjust the AI’s performance through continuous feedback and retraining.

Scaling AI writing solutions requires an iterative process of fine-tuning, ensuring that content remains relevant and accurate despite increasing volumes.

Performance Metrics for AI Content Production

Metric Description
Content Quality Accuracy, tone, and engagement levels of the generated text.
Content Volume The number of articles, blog posts, or pieces of content generated over a set period.
Time Efficiency The time taken by AI to generate content compared to manual writing processes.